How The Rankings Actually Work
High tiers get plus frames on key moves and safe pressure strings. Mid tiers offer tricky mixups but risky habits. Lower tiers struggle against dedicated zoning and fast reaction teams.
Players test matchups in training mode first. They log results in shared spreadsheets. Research shows consistent patterns across different regions and skill groups.

Q: Is this list still accurate in 2025?
A: Core strengths and flaws remain similar, though netcode changes may shift a few spots.
Q: Can a lower tier character beat a top tier one?
A: Yes, skill, matchup knowledge, and experience gaps can easily reverse tier predictions.
